Jon Favreau presented the series "Star Wars: The Mandalorian" and the film "Grogu" at the world premiere

[Sunday, May 17, 2026 | Views: 50]

At yesterday's world premiere of Star Wars: The Mandalorian and Grogu, director and co-writer Jon Favreau took the stage at the TCL Chinese Theater to introduce the film and talk about how his father took him to see Star Wars 49 years ago, which inspired his film career.

Sigourney Weaver's handprint ceremony at the TCL Chinese Theater in Hollywood

[Sunday, May 17, 2026 | Views: 44]

Sigourney Weaver was honored this morning, May 15, with a handprint ceremony in front of the TCL Chinese Theater in Hollywood. The event was attended by James Cameron, Jon Favreau, Dave Filoni, Kathleen Kennedy and Pedro Pascal.

Top 20 best Star Wars games - according to Metacritic

[Saturday, May 16, 2026 | Views: 47]

In honor of Star Wars Day, Metacritic has shared a list of the 20 highest-rated games in the franchise.

The site does not have all Star Wars titles, so the site editors did not include many games from the 80s and 90s in their top list.

The leader, as expected, was Knights of the Old Republic, followed by Jedi Knight: Dark Forces II, and Rogue Leader: Rogue Squadron II rounding out the top three.

The creators of Star Wars Zero Company published new art and promised to share news soon

[Friday, May 15, 2026 | Views: 55]

Last Monday, May 4th, the day dedicated to Star Wars ended without a single video game announcement. Some were hoping for the reveal of Star Wars Jedi 3, while others were waiting for updates on already announced projects such as Star Wars Eclipse.

In the end, the only game that showed itself was Star Wars Zero Company, a single-player turn-based tactics game developed by Bit Reactor. The studio published new art and hinted at upcoming news.

So, Star Wars Zero Company may appear at the Summer Game Fest presentation next month.

New 'The Mandalorian and Grogu' Promo Hints at Clone Wars Villain's Important Role

[Wednesday, May 13, 2026 | Views: 59]

The Mandalorian & Grogu is the most important Star Wars project in years. The success of the film could directly determine the future of the franchise in terms of feature releases and whether big money will continue to be invested in Disney+ series.

In China, Disney and Lucasfilm launched a promotional campaign for the blockbuster. One of the posters featured the villain Embo, introduced in the animated series The Clone Wars. It is noteworthy that he is the only antagonist, which may indicate a key place in the plot.

This isn't the first time Embo has appeared in marketing materials, and it's also not the first time Lucasfilm has hinted at his important role in the project. An advertising banner with the villain was spotted in a shopping center.

Finale to Ahsoka's Star Wars Story Set - Season 2 Status Updated

[Wednesday, May 13, 2026 | Views: 49]

News has emerged about the second season of Ahsoka, the details of which have not yet been shared.

In an interview with ScreenRant Lucasfilm creative director Dave Filoni spoke about the status of the Ahsoka sequel. According to him, the team is now working hard on visual effects.

We're working on it! Everything is in full swing. Obviously, I'm currently editing all the episodes at the same time and am deep into the visual effects with the team. But I'm really proud of everyone and the work they did. There's still a lot to be decided and figured out, but that's okay.

I'm glad people will see this. I think the team is really excited to bring this season to the fans and see how it goes.

When asked to give an approximate release date for the second season of Ahsoka, Filoni indicated that he knew the date. However, now he cannot even name the release window: “Everything needs its moment. Now is Maul’s moment.”

Star Wars sequels won't be removed from canon, despite rumors

[Tuesday, May 12, 2026 | Views: 44]

The Star Wars fan community is once again "outraged in the Force." Fans began asking Lucasfilm to remove sequels from the canon and instead make film adaptations of Timothy Zahn's Thrawn novels.

YouTube bloggers who talk about the franchise quickly noticed this opportunity. Geeks and Gamers claimed that "sources" told them that Ahsoka Season 2 (or later) would cancel the events of Episodes 7-9.

YouTubers quickly realized that modern social media algorithms respond more to anger and rage. Sometimes it reaches an almost comical level. That is why the hate of the series “Acolyte” received a lot of views.

Star Wars Comics Announcement: May 13, 2026

[Tuesday, May 12, 2026 | Views: 52]

On Wednesday, 1 new Star Wars comic will hit store shelves.

The first season of Maul: Shadow Lord has come to an end on Disney+, but Benjamin Percy presents the third installment in the exciting mini-series Shadow of Maul. Lawson is being pursued by a hitman and an officer from his own department! An unexpected ally comes to the rescue - a crime boss named Wario, who has his own hidden plans. And Maul begins preparations for a robbery in Janix by kidnapping a police officer! Percy's creative team once again includes Madibek Musabekov and Luis Guerrero.
